Splitting matrix into fixed rows and N columns

Hello,
I have a matrix 3900x3. My goal is to rearrange it every 30x3 values in order to gain a resulting matrix of 30x130. I guess it is a simple task but I am pretty new into matlab codes and could not find any tips on the internet. Hope I clearly explained the problem

A 3900-by-3 matrix contains 11700 elements, but a 30-by-130 matrix has only 3900, so you can't just reshape the former to get to the latter. Explain better how to move from the first matrix to the second.
I need to rearrange the 3900-by-3 [A B C] matrix concatenating it horizontally every 30-by-3 values.
So the resulting matrix will be 30-by [A B C A B C A B C ...] 390.

M_new = M(1:30,:);
For i=2:130
M_new = horzcat(M_new, M(30*(i-1)+1:30*i,:)); % M is your original matrix (3900 x 3)
end
